Wayne Lawerence Nichol, age 78, passed away peacefully on February 26, 2025, at the
Killarney Bayside Personal Care Home with his wife Adelyn by his side.
Wayne was born in Killarney, Manitoba on January 23, 1947, first of 4 sons (Wayne,
Ronald, Kelvin, Gordon) to Ivan and Norma Nichol and was raised in the Rosevalley
district and lived his entire life on Rosevalley road, from attending Rosevalley school,
raising his family, farming the land, to retirement and enjoying his regular drives through
the area.
Wayne and Adelyn married on May 4, 1968, and moved into their house on the farm
that same year, and had their two children, Kevin on November 1, 1968, and Lorrie was
born on April 30, 1970.
Wayne & Adelyn farmed with his father Ivan, Uncle Mert, and 3 brothers for many years,
in the late 1990’s Wayne and brother Kelvin remained farming grain and cattle primarily
and ventured into the hog production industry.
Wayne became reeve of the Municipality of Killarney-Turtle Mountain in 1989, serving
on the council to 2005 and Wayne enjoyed serving the community and all the
friendships he made along the way.
Beyond his love of farming and council, Wayne was a member of the Killarney Elks
club, board member on the Killarney Foundation for many years, he was always looking
to support the community and betterment of the town and municipality. Wayne also
spent numerous hours volunteering for community initiatives such as the Killarney
Heritage Home for the Arts, Tri-Lake Health Centre, the curling club, & the legion.
Wayne was an avid lifelong curler and enjoyed liniment league baseball in his younger
days, then took up golf in his later years, the social environment made for some
memorable times and best of friends.
Wayne & Adelyn were blessed with wonderful granddaughters and spent as much time
as possible with them growing up, enjoying school events, sporting activities, travel, and
being a special part of their lives.
In 2008 Wayne and Adelyn began spending winters in south Texas and spent 13 years
traveling down south to enjoy the warm winter months taking in golf, and social events.
In 2013 Wayne & Kelvin sold the farming business to retire from farming, though
Wayne kept the farm house and 21 acres of land that would be home to a dozen or two
cow/calve pairs every spring and summer to keep the grass down but also for the
enjoyment of hobby farming, even when he had to round them up and fix fence, it
created some amusement along Rosevalley road with the neighbours. Wayne and
Kelvin kept haying the local area for many years as a way of maintaining grass areas
and enjoyment of being out on the land together.
Wayne and Adelyn were fortunate after retirement to take in many adventures travelling
the world with friends and family, bringing home memories and new friendships from
every trip.
It was on November 8, 2022, Wayne suffered a life changing incident when a fall on the
curling ice would end with a traumatic brain injury creating dementia and downturn in his
health. Wayne passed away peacefully at Bayside Personal Care Home.
